Exactly How Cold Laser Treatment Works



Utilizing low-level laser light to stimulate cellular function and advertise cells healing, cold laser therapy functions by targeting specific areas of the body to minimize pain and aid in recovery.

When the chilly laser is related to the skin, the light energy penetrates the underlying tissues and interacts with the cells. This communication sets off a series of organic responses at the mobile level, including enhanced production of adenosine triphosphate (ATP), the power resource for cells.

The heightened ATP production then boosts cellular metabolic rate, causing sped up tissue repair service and lowered swelling.

Additionally, cold laser treatment helps to stimulate blood flow in the targeted area, promoting the distribution of oxygen and nutrients important for recovery. The light energy also has a pain-relieving impact by obstructing discomfort signals sent by nerves and launching endorphins, the body's all-natural medicines.
